Dive into a gripping underwater memoir that blends danger, discovery, and hard-won wisdom.
- Second edition in GRAYSCALE (not color) presents Randy Lathrop’s life as both commercial and recreational diver across the Caribbean, Atlantic, the Great Lakes, and Florida’s submerged caves.
- A treasure-hunting narrative at heart: accidental Spanish gold finds, salvage work on famed wrecks, and the pursuit of the 1715 La Esclavitud with courtroom drama and real stakes.
- Vivid itineraries include Florida’s Treasure Coast, The Bahamas, Turks and Caicos, Belize, Lake Huron, and Nahoch Nah Chich—the world’s longest cave system in Mexico—told with detail and emotion.
- Over 150 photos, 4 maps, a complete index, and footnotes complement the narrative; his underwater videography has reached audiences on History Channel, NBC, Smithsonian Magazine, and more.
- 356 pages in a 9 x 6 inch paperback; a substantial, page-turning memoir for divers and history buffs alike.
